Websubject to IRS limits. • Pretax traditional and after-tax Roth 401 (k) plans available. • EJM provides a 60% matching contribution of your pretax. contributions, up to the first 20% of your contributions per pay. • The matching contribution has a graded vesting schedule; with 100% vesting after six years of service.
